There's z bridal studio in Bradford who have been holding courses for 3 years. I looked at their portfolio and the work is actually better than sadaf. 7 day course is for £1200 which also includes 2 days of shadowing sahida (owner of z bridals) on her live bookings. For another £450 she holds 4 days intense training on threading, facials and waxing. You become a part of their team after which helps you gain more experience afterwards. They help you build a portfolio too!

A friend of a friend got trained by z bridal and she says its well worth it and you learn a lot. You just need to practice a lot afterwards.

I'm not a big fan of these 7 day courses, but its the best one I have come across so far. Still unsure of where to get trained from, but if I cant find anyone better then I'm going to train with z bridals in September.
